Job Duties:

The Resch School of Engineering at UW-Green Bay is inviting applications for a tenure-track faculty position in Mechanical Engineering at the rank of Assistant Professor, starting in January 2026. We are seeking highly qualified and motivated individuals passionate about teaching labs and courses and shaping the future of our Mechanical Engineering program. Preference will be given to candidates with expertise in Materials, Manufacturing, or Controls and Automation.

The successful candidate will collaborate with industry leaders, engage in real-world projects, and prepare students for the dynamic field of mechanical engineering.


Key

Job Responsibilities:

  • Teach a course load of 21 contact hours per academic year, with a 3-credit remission in the first academic year.
  • Instruct both theory and lab courses in the Mechanical Engineering and Mechanical Engineering Technology programs.
  • Conduct assessment activities associated with ABET accreditation.
  • Demonstrate a commitment to student success through active learning, high student engagement, and teamwork-focused pedagogical approaches.
  • Advise and mentor students
  • Develop a strong research program involving collaboration with students and faculty.
  • Perform scholarly activities consistent with rank.
  • Participate in institutional and community service.
  • Contribute to ongoing program development.
  • Implement inclusive instructional strategies to support students from underrepresented and first-generation backgrounds at UW-Green Bay.

Required Qualifications:

  • Earned doctorate in Mechanical Engineering or a closely related field from an accredited institution, to be completed no later than December 2025. However, we may consider ABD candidates who can demonstrate the ability to meet the requirements above.
  • Demonstrated potential for excellence in teaching
  • Demonstrated potential for excellence in research.


Preferred Qualifications:

  • A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ering.
  • Expertise in Materials, Manufacturing, or Controls and Automation.
  • Commitment to interdisciplinary collaboration and innovative pedagogical approaches


Conditions of Appointment:

Position is an academic year tenure-track appointment. Applicants must be considered for tenure and promotion in six years, although tenure decisions may be at any time. Promotion from Assistant to Associate Professor is simultaneous with tenure. Excellence in teaching, sustained scholarly activity and institutional service required for retention and promotion.
